Cats can be a natural deterrent for snakes due to their hunting instincts. However, they might not always be effective in keeping snakes away. While a cat’s presence can discourage smaller snakes, it’s not a guaranteed solution for larger or highly venomous snakes. To effectively manage snake presence, it's better to keep your yard clean, seal entry points, and consult professional pest control.
